
Water means life, since it
is the vehicle that carries:
- Glucose and oxygen to the cells;
- Nourishment, residues and mineral salts;
- Controls body temperature
75% of human being body is water, distributed
as follows:
- Brain: 75%;
- Lungs: 86%;
- Kidney: 83%;
- Muscles: 81%;
- Heart: 75%;
- Liver: 86%;
- Blood: 75%.

When opening the house faucet,
sometimes the user is not having the same water quality existing
in the city reservoir. The water treatment in great cities does
not depend only on the estate or city water companies. There are
several issues linked to the final product quality. The water
contamination or pollution can take place within the pipeline
or even at the water tank in your house or building.
Regular cleaning on the water tank should be one of your main
concerns in order to maintain the water quality. Lack of hygienic
procedures in this case could generate a contamination spot in
the water system of your home. This is why the water coming to
your house has to carry a certain amount of chlorine, needed to
disinfect the water, to avoid the bacteria and worms proliferation,
but it has to be eliminated before human consumption.

Around 80% of all diseases and more than one third of deaths
in underdeveloped countries are related to polluted water consumption,
since it is a remarkable vehicle for illness spreading, especially
on the intestinal system.

Huge amounts of water are spent in almost every industrial process:
- To produce 1 ton of steel, over 280 tons of water are consumed;
- To make 1 kilo of paper, there is a need of 700 kilos of
water;
- To build a typical American car, the manufacturer uses 50
times its weight in water;
- To process just 1 frozen chicken, at least 26 liters of water
are spent.
